One of the most important aspects of safe online betting is selecting a reputable betting site. Look for platforms that are licensed and regulated by recognized authorities. This ensures that they follow strict guidelines to protect players. Check for reviews and ratings from other users to get a sense of the site's trustworthiness.
When betting online, it is vital to use secure payment methods to protect your financial information. Sites that offer multiple payment options, including credit cards, e-wallets, and cryptocurrency, often provide additional security measures. Always check if the site uses SSL encryption to ensure that your data is safeguarded during transactions.
Setting and adhering to a betting budget is crucial for responsible gambling. Decide in advance how much money you are willing to lose without affecting your financial stability. Avoid chasing losses by betting more than your budget allows – this can lead to a cycle of loss that becomes hard to break.

Before placing bets, ensure you have a clear understanding of the games or sports you are betting on. Familiarize yourself with the rules, odds, and strategies involved in each game. Knowledge can significantly enhance your chances of making informed bets and can result in a more enjoyable experience.
Responsible gambling means knowing your limits and recognizing when to take a break. There are tools provided by many betting platforms that allow you to set betting limits, time-outs, and self-exclusion options. Use these features to manage your gambling habits actively and avoid potential addiction.
When participating in online betting, be cautious about the personal information you share. Legitimate betting sites will not ask for sensitive information like your social security number or bank account details via email or chat. Always use secure channels for any communication regarding your account.
Many betting sites offer bonuses to attract new clients. While these promotions can be attractive, it's crucial to read the terms and conditions carefully. Bonuses often come with wagering requirements that must be met before you can withdraw winnings. Ensure you are comfortable with these conditions before accepting any bonuses.
Maintaining a record of your bets, wins, and losses can help you analyze your gambling habits and make better decisions in the future. Using a betting journal or app can provide insights into patterns in your betting behavior, helping you to adjust your strategies accordingly.

With the rise of mobile betting, many users now prefer apps to access betting sites. When using mobile applications, ensure you download them from well-known sources and keep them updated to benefit from the latest security patches. Avoid using public Wi-Fi to place bets or make transactions; instead, opt for a secure, private network.
Gambling laws differ significantly from one jurisdiction to another. Familiarize yourself with the regulations and laws in your area to ensure you're betting legally. Engaging in illegal betting can result in serious consequences, including fines or worse. Always prioritize compliance with local laws when gambling online.
It's essential to recognize when to stop betting. Whether you're on a winning streak or facing losses, sticking to a predetermined limit will help maintain control. If you find yourself feeling stressed or anxious about your gambling, it might be time to step back and reassess your approach. Seek professional help if necessary.
If you or someone you know is struggling with gambling, connecting with support groups can provide the necessary assistance. Organizations such as Gamblers Anonymous offer valuable resources and community support for individuals dealing with gambling-related issues. Don’t hesitate to reach out for help.
